Transaction 51ea8b5129f588fa43e5f5e2d03f1c492378d0f0935a987eff38534d07f59d29
1 Input
1 Output
-
51ea8b5129f588fa43e5f5e2d03f1c492378d0f0935a987eff38534d07f59d29:0
- value
- 11572089
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a31e5d0cbb0f7bd448bddac9910437bec6835f00 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FsVWxfAk4EiLeV6WePji82S282pZdcrMW